Camden, located in Camden County, New Jersey, was originally settled in the early 17th century by the Lenape Native Americans and later by European colonists. The area became a significant industrial center in the 19th century, particularly during the development of the shipping and transportation industries due to its strategic location along the Delaware River. Camden's population boomed with the establishment of factories and shipyards, but it faced economic decline in the late 20th century due to deindustrialization. Today, Camden is undergoing revitalization efforts, focusing on urban renewal and community development.
